About SPDR S&P Retail ETF (NYSEARCA:XRT)

SPDR S&P Retail ETF (the Fund) seeks to replicate as closely as possible the performance of the S&P Retail Select Industry Index (the Index). The Index is an equal weighted market cap index. The Index represents the retail sub-industry portion of the S&P Total Market Index. The Fund invests in industries, such as apparel retail, automotive retail, food retail, department stores, Internet retail, general merchandise stores, drug retail, and hypermarkets and super centers. The Fund’s investment advisor is SSgA Funds Management, Inc.

What does XRT invest in?

SPDR S&P Retail ETF is a equity fund issued by SSgA. XRT focuses on consumer discretionary investments and follows the S&P Retail Index. The fund's investments total to approximately $635.36 million assets under management.

What is the management fee for SPDR S&P Retail ETF?

SPDR S&P Retail ETF's management fee is 0.35% and has no other recorded expenses or fee waivers. The net expense ratio for XRT is 0.35%.
